1st step. Calculate the area of the parallelogram

We can use the following formula:

A=b\cdot h

where,

base, b = 9 km

height, h = 5 km

Therefore,

A=9\cdot5=45

The area of the parallelogram is 45 km^2

2nd step. Calculate the area of the triangle

Let's use this formula:

A=\frac{b\cdot h}{2}

where,

base, b = 6 km

height, h = 3 km

Therefore,

A=\frac{6\cdot3}{2}=9

The area of the triangle is 9 km^2

3rd step. calculates the ratio of the area of the parallelogram to the area of the triangle

r=\frac{A_P}{A_T}=\frac{45}{9}=5

Answer: the area of the parallelogram is 5 times greater than the area of the triangle.
